Case Studies
Client: Deer Park Spring Water, New Jersey
Situation: Deer Park Spring Water doubled in size in eighteen months, as a result of an aggressive acquisition strategy. The new network of facilities and the related management teams were not on the same page in their business strategies, leadership philosophies and practices. Senior Management’s “Bench Strength” was lacking and the business system as a whole was hemorrhaging cash and talent. The business was rumored to be sold off by its holding company, presumably at a substantial loss.
Nature of Engagement: Working with Senior Management, we created a comprehensive strategic direction targeted at moving the company to profitability within six months.
InterOctave used a series of tiered workshops designed to challenge management to reconceptualize the strategy, develop leadership capabilities and upgrade operational effectiveness
Cross-functional Leadership teams understood how the actions they took daily effected earnings, margins and cash flows and how to develop their people toward self-managing, self-motivating, capabilities.
Functional and operational groups learned to ensure that all of their business process work was in alignment in the new strategy: which included extensive evaluation and re-design of the IT infrastructure.
Results:
-
Development of a distinctive, compelling, executable strategy that aligned all efforts toward profitability and value creation in the market and communities
-
Development of a “value adding process” (from supplier to customer) view that integrated 48 locations into an effective, highly profitable network
-
Final product cost reduction of an average of 20%, with simultaneous improved client relationships.
-
250% improvement in profitability in two years, with the company “in the black” in the first four months.
-
Capability to lead change provided large numbers of promoteabilty managers for the next 3 years that were greatly sought after by the rest of the company and others.
-
Consciousness of systems impact lead to bottle reformulation and changes in research and delivery model.
